Rice and Beans with Dried Beef (Baião de Dois com Carne Seca)

  • Total Time - 70 minutes
  • Prep Time - 20 minutes
  • Cook Time - 50 minutes
  • Servings: 4
  • Country: Brazil
A rich Baião de Dois with carne seca, rice, and beans, garnished with chopped scallions and cheese.

Baião de Dois is a dish that embodies northeastern Brazil. It combines two basic ingredients—rice and beans—and elevates them into a complex culinary experience. The preparation is simple, but the flavor is rich thanks to 'carne seca' and 'queijo coalho' cheese. If these ingredients are not available, you can use dried beef found in local stores and another semi-hard cheese. It is important to be mindful of the saltiness of the dish due to the 'carne seca'.

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 250 g carne seca (dried beef), rehydrated and cooked
  • 1 cup cooked beans (e.g., 'feijão fradinho' or other)
  • 1 cup rice, uncooked
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 0.5 red bell pepper,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up 'queijo coalho' cheese cubes or similar cheese, cubed
  • 0.5 cup fresh parsley or cilantro, chopped
  • 1 to taste salt and black pepper

Instructions

Step 1: Preparing the Meat and Beans

Soak the carne seca for several hours to remove the salt, then cook it until tender. Shred the meat into fibers and set it aside. Cook the beans in salted water and also set them aside.

Step 2: Preparing the Base

In a large pot or pan with a lid,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té until soft. Add the garlic and bell pepper and sauté for another 2 minutes.

Step 3: Cooking the Rice

Add the rice to the pan and mix well with the vegetables. Pour in the chicken broth.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and cover. Cook for about 15 minutes, or until the rice is almost done.

Step 4: Finishing and Serving

When the rice is almost cooked, add the cooked beans, shredded carne seca, and cheese cubes to the pot. Gently mix to combine the ingredients, and let it cook for another 5-10 minutes, until the cheese melts and the dish is heated through. Season with salt and pepper. Garnish with fresh cilantro or parsley before serving.
